Product reviews:
NCM Bikes electric bike german manufacturer
electric bike german manufacturer
Lester
2026-02-28 iphone 11 Pro
bike is 3D printed and electric electric bike german manufacturer
electric bike german manufacturer
Prescott
2026-02-24 iphone X
German Company Bosch Ask Its Workers to electric bike german manufacturer
electric bike german manufacturer